Transaction 00d18395e0087414afbf7b51c577ced055a67762d8f98b48cd143d6f0322486f

1 Input
2 Outputs
  • 00d18395e0087414afbf7b51c577ced055a67762d8f98b48cd143d6f0322486f:0
  • value  263951
    address  3NuD3RYhjdJZdjesVBk8ft118intVXczsk
  • 00d18395e0087414afbf7b51c577ced055a67762d8f98b48cd143d6f0322486f:1
  • value  13352794
    address  1BsTSRSK3B7cBWJwEeDcif75MCRxnf5gRm